GrossGuroGirl

Yeah - honestly it's frustrating for an artist to do badly and acknowledge it, then have everyone go "oh noooo it was so gooooood don't worrrryyyyyy."  Like, great. Either the times I was proud of my work weren't actually noticeably better than this, or you're lying to me - which, especially for someone struggling with depression, just exacerbates internal doubts over time. You start to lose trust that any reassurance is genuine.  It's one thing to address unusually self-critical *phrasing,* or a pattern where they think everything they do sucks. But otherwise it's just infantilizing. The key idea is it's okay to fuck up sometimes, and that's not a direct reflection of you as a person/artist. Not to convince everyone they never fuck up.
